  1. Deep Web/Invisible Web Brigid Hoban Surface Web DEEP WEB

  2. Definition • Deep Web: Content on the Web that is not found in most search engine results, because it is stored in a database rather than on HTML pages. • Invisible Web: The portion of the Web not accessible through Web search engines. Invisible Web + Deep Web = Same thing

  3. What is the Deep Web? • Web that is not visible to the public • Has not been indexed by the search engines EXAMPLE: Neumann's library

  4. How to use the Deep Web? • Direct Search • Invisible Web Directory • Resource Discovery Network • InfoMine • Virtual Library

  5. How the Deep Web valuable in a class room setting? • embraces information that traditional search engines (Google) do not usually access • information usually takes the form of databases • information is suppose more specific
